Tour Details

Want to discover the most terrifying secrets of Seattle? If so, we'll meet you at the indicated time on Union Street, where we'll start our walking tour to discover the city's dark alleys, old theatres and mortuaries. Each step will take us back in time to a mysterious past!

We'll start in front of the Four Seasons Hotel, where the stories will take us back to the year 1850. What tragic event took place in this place? Why are spectral figures still seen in the surroundings?

While we tell you what happened and give you goosebumps, we'll enter the Post Alley. In this famously haunted alley, we'll discover Pike Place Market, where many of the people who work there claim to feel a presence at times in the early evening.

Next, we'll reach the Market Theatre and be greeted by the mournful atmosphere of the spirits of the vaudeville performers, whose laughter and applause still echo into the night.

Ready for even more fear? Next, we'll set off for the mortuary at number 21 of 1st Avenue, a building whose architecture was designed specifically to house the dead. Will we hear any of the echoes coming from the empty corridors?

Finally, we'll stop at the Moore Theatre, built over Seattle's first cemetery. Did you know that workers report seeing translucent figures and hearing whispers in the corners? How horrifying! Because of its history, this spot has been the epicentre of several unexplained phenomena, making it the most haunted place in Seattle.

After an hour of chills, we'll say goodbye at this last building—watch out for what you find on your way back!
